What certificate(s) do I need?

• (You need to get permission from your teacher and parent/guardian first!)

• Human Subject Certificate: If you are testing on any humans besides yourself. However, any experiment that is harmful, painful, or degrading to people are NOT ALLOWED!

• Vertebrate Certificate: If you are testing on any living creature with a backbone besides a human (examples: birds, dogs, cats and fish). However, any experiment that is harmful, painful, or degrading to any living creature with a backbone is NOT ALLOWED!

What certificate(s) do I need?

• Hazard Control Certificate: If you using any possible harmful substance or equipment (fire, bacteria, lasers, bleach, acids..etc). You must have adult supervision who is licensed or a professional in your topic experiment. (doctor, engineer, professor, teacher..etc.)

• Living Tissue Certificate: If you are testing on any organic tissue from human or animal (hair, skin, organs, teeth…etc), you can not get the organic tissue by yourself.

Experimenting

• When your child is doing his or her experiment, they must do at least 8 trials or times.

• Record all observations, if the experiment fails, what you did to “fix” the failure, etc.

• Must use the metric system as the method of measurement.– Meters (Area/Distance)– Liters (Volume)– Grams (Weight)– Seconds (Time)

2+ week/timed experiments

• Have 3 or more variables to observe long term (different plants, different bread to mold..etc.).

• For 2+ week long experiments write observations/data at least every 2 to 3 days.

• For most timed experiments like how long does a battery last or dissolving marshmallow, it can be measure in seconds, minutes, hours or days.

Survey Experiments

• Have 3 or more variables to test

• at least 50 human/animal test subjects,

• 5 or more appropriate questions with an appropriate activity

• documentation for each person survey. Each person survey must be anonymous.
